Provides, under title XVIII (Medicare) of the Social Security Act, that payment may be made for durable medical equipment and for breast prosthesis and orthepedic shoes. Extends coverage of the medicare program to qualified individuals in the United States and Canada.
Directs the Health Insurance Benefits Advisory Council to conduct a detailed review and study of the medicare benefits program, with special emphasis on: (1) determining the extent to which such programs serve the interests of patients thereunder; (2) identifying particular problems and problem areas thereunder; and (3) determining the legislative and administrative actions which need to be taken in order to make such programs work more effectively.
Requires the Council to submit to the Secretary of Health, Education, and Welfare for immediate transmission to the Congress a full and complete report on the study conducted pursuant to this Act.
